Output 59d3e529eedb6d42d807352cc4cbc77b6b8ea737eade468161479edf976075e1:1

value
127843
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 60ae42f8c9802231515a256abd082e8a8be51681e8b3d052ed49edb7bd257d44
address
bc1pvzhy97xfsq3rz526y44t6zpw3297295pazeaq5hdf8km00f904zq9wzzjn
transaction
59d3e529eedb6d42d807352cc4cbc77b6b8ea737eade468161479edf976075e1
confirmations
65252
spent
true